Egypt bids for Palestinian reconciliation

Emiratesvoice, emirates voice

Emiratesvoice, emirates voice Egypt bids for Palestinian reconciliation

Cairo – Akram Ali

Egyptian political parties launched the initiative “Egyptian revolution for Palestinian reconciliation” to unite the Palestinians and end the continuous division between Hamas and Fatah. The initiative was launched by the Union of Revolutionary Youth, Democratic Revolutionary Coalition, the United Revolutionary Front and Freedom and Justice party. The Egyptian intelligence took the responsibility of handling the Palestinian reconciliation for many years, and still attempting to harmonise the two Palestinian parties. With the efforts of Nabil al-Arabi, Egyptian Minister of Foreign Affairs at the time, the reconciliation was agreed after January 25 revolution but has still not been applied. Union of Revolutionary Youth spokesman Tamer al-Kady told Arabstoday that the initiative was very welcomed by the Palestinian youth in Gaza and the West Bank, and the Palestinian factions including Hamas and Fatah. He said there are several visions and new ideas starting to form through a series of meetings between the members of the initiative and the Palestinian leaders and activists. He said: \"What’s new about this initiative is that it started from meeting Palestinian citizens, activists, and leaders of the second and third rows of the Palestinian factions.” A Freedom and Justice party member told Arabstoday that the initiative will be studying all the negotiations and proposals between Hamas and Fatah, as well as all the failed agreements. He pointed out that this new revolutionary initiative has new ideas and mechanism that were not raised before and that will be revealed after concluding all the meetings and the related initiatives. Ayman Amer, the coordinator of the Democratic Revolutionary Coalition, said that the initiative will organise visits to Gaza and Ramallah to meet the Palestinian citizens and listen to their point of view and ideas. Fatah leader Riyad Saidam said: “Israel is the main player in the division between Palestinian factions; Islamic movement Hamas, Fatah movement, Islamic Jihad movement or other Palestinian resistance movements. The Zionist entity has an advanced political and psychological agenda which attempt sometimes to controlPalestinian politics. They arrest and eliminate the leaders who seek Palestinian reconciliation as the martyrs Sheikh Ahmed Yassin and Yasser Arafat.” During the press conference held in the occasion of launching the initiative, Saturday evening in Akhbar Alyoum institution, Saidam said that the analysis of the Palestinian issue is based on individuals and divisions where the Palestinian cause, the territory and the Judaisation efforts are ignored by the occupier of the Arab Palestinian territory.
